145得票4回答
为什么Unicorn需要与Nginx一起部署?

我希望了解Nginx和Unicorn之间的区别。据我所知,Nginx是一个Web服务器,而Unicorn是一个Ruby HTTP服务器。 既然Nginx和Unicorn都可以处理HTTP请求,为什么需要在RoR应用程序中使用Nginx和Unicorn的组合呢?

19得票2回答
在Heroku上配置Puma集群

我需要关于在我的RoR4 Heroku应用上配置Puma(多线程+多核服务器)的帮助。Heroku文档并不是最新的。我按照这篇文章:Concurrency and Database Connections 进行了配置,但是它没有提到如何为集群进行配置,所以我不得不同时使用两种类型(线程和多核)...

21得票2回答
尝试使用nginx和unicorn配置rails应用程序为SSL时出现了太多重定向错误

我正在尝试使用Nginx和Unicorn为Rails应用程序配置SSL。 我正在尝试在本地设置它。 为此,我首先使用OpenSSL为Nginx创建了自签名证书。 我遵循了文档 创建自签名证书的步骤。 之后,我在http块内将我的nginx.conf配置如下: upstream unicorn...

8得票1回答
当我使用unicorn启动我的Rails应用程序时出现了奇怪的错误。

我尝试用独角兽启动我的Rails应用程序时,遇到了一个非常奇怪的错误。有人以前见过吗? [root@Web01 mp_app]# unicorn_rails -c config/unicorn.rb -E production -D -d {:daemonize=>true, :ap...

19得票2回答
Mac开发模式下Thin和Unicorn有什么区别?

我很震惊这个问题还没有被问过,但是我发誓我已经到处找过了。在开发模式下运行Rails 3时,使用thin和unicorn有哪些优势或劣势?

10得票1回答
在使用Nginx(或Apache)时是否必须将Unicorn放在其后面?

我对这种架构有点困惑。在我正在处理的项目中,Unicorn被选为Rails服务器,并放置在Nginx Web服务器后面。据我了解,Unicorn是一个完全功能的Web服务器,我们不打算在同一服务器实例上托管任何其他Rails应用。 因此,我的问题是:在链中增加额外层的好处是什么:client ...

9得票5回答
优秀的独角兽 + nginx + cap deploy 如何操作?

有人能推荐一个好的 unicorn + nginx + cap 部署 how to 吗?我已经搜索了很久,在部署过程中遇到各种错误,花了5个小时左右。

11得票2回答
独角兽卡住了,显示“正在刷新Gem”

我在从Phusion Passenger迁移到Unicorn后,在staging环境中出现了奇怪的问题。 我已经为开发环境和staging环境都配置了Unicorn,它在开发环境下工作正常,但在staging环境下不起作用。在开发环境下,它监听8080端口,而在staging环境下,它监听U...

7得票2回答
如何配置nginx + Unicorn以避免超时错误?

我有一个运行在nginx + Unicorn(Ubuntu 12.04)上的Rails应用程序(v3.2.13,Ruby 2.0.0)。一切都很顺利,除了当管理员用户通过CVS文件上传用户时(数千个),我设置了30秒的超时时间,但是导入过程需要更长的时间。因此,30秒后我会得到一个nginx ...

11得票6回答
Rails无法读取环境变量

我希望将一个Rails应用程序部署到生产环境,但是我遇到了一个问题,Rails无法看到我的环境变量。 我已经在我的.bashrc文件中设置了数据库密码。export APP_NAME_DATABASE_PASSWORD=secretkey 在irb中ENV["APP_NAME_DATABAS...